ブログ(Claude Code) PR

Claude Codeのインストール手順を徹底解説|初心者でも簡単導入

記事内に商品プロモーションを含む場合があります

Claude Codeのインストール方法を初心者向けに詳しく解説。事前準備から実際のインストール手順、初期設定まで画像付きで分かりやすく説明します。トラブルシューティングや便利な使い方のコツも紹介。AI開発環境を今すぐ構築しましょう。

Claude Codeとは?導入前に知っておくべき基礎知識

Claude CodeはAnthropic社が開発した革新的なAIコーディングアシスタントツールです。従来のコーディング環境とは一線を画す高度な自然言語処理能力により、開発者の生産性を劇的に向上させることができます。
このツールの最大の特徴は、複雑なプログラミングタスクを自然言語で指示するだけで、高品質なコードを生成できる点にあります。初心者から上級者まで、あらゆるレベルの開発者が恩恵を受けることができる画期的なソリューションと言えるでしょう。
Claude Codeは単なるコード生成ツールではありません。デバッグ支援、コードレビュー、リファクタリング提案など、開発プロセス全体をサポートする包括的な機能を提供しています。特に複雑なアルゴリズムの実装や、新しい技術スタックの学習において、その真価を発揮します。

システム要件と事前準備

システム要件と事前準備

Claude Codeをスムーズに導入するためには、まず適切なシステム環境の準備が必要です。最低限の要件として、Windows 10以降、macOS 10.15以降、またはUbuntu 18.04以降のオペレーティングシステムが必要になります。
メモリに関しては、最低8GBのRAMを推奨していますが、大規模なプロジェクトを扱う場合は16GB以上を用意することで、より快適な開発体験を得ることができます。ストレージ容量については、少なくとも10GBの空き容量を確保しておくことが重要です。
ネットワーク環境も重要な要素の一つです。Claude Codeはクラウドベースのサービスと連携するため、安定したインターネット接続が必須となります。ファイアウォールの設定によっては、特定のポートを開放する必要がある場合もありますので、事前に確認しておきましょう。

アカウント作成とライセンス取得

インストール作業を開始する前に、Claude Codeの公式アカウントを作成する必要があります。公式ウェブサイトにアクセスし、「Sign Up」ボタンをクリックしてアカウント作成画面に進みます。
メールアドレスとパスワードを入力し、利用規約に同意してアカウントを作成します。登録したメールアドレスに確認メールが送信されますので、メール内のリンクをクリックしてアカウントの有効化を完了させてください。
ライセンスプランについては、個人利用向けの無料プランから、チーム開発に適したビジネスプランまで複数の選択肢があります。初回利用者には30日間の無料トライアル期間が提供されているため、まずは試用版で機能を確認することをお勧めします。

インストーラーのダウンロード

インストーラーのダウンロード

アカウントの準備が完了したら、いよいよインストーラーのダウンロードに進みます。公式ダッシュボードにログイン後、「Downloads」セクションから使用中のオペレーティングシステムに対応したインストーラーを選択します。
Windows版、Mac版、Linux版それぞれに最適化されたインストーラーが提供されています。ダウンロードファイルのサイズは約500MBですので、安定したネットワーク環境でダウンロードすることを強く推奨します。
ダウンロード完了後は、ファイルの整合性を確認するため、提供されているハッシュ値と比較検証を行いましょう。これにより、ダウンロード過程でのファイル破損やセキュリティリスクを回避できます。

Windows環境でのインストール手順

Windowsユーザーの場合、ダウンロードしたexeファイルを管理者権限で実行してインストールを開始します。インストールウィザードが起動したら、「Next」ボタンをクリックして次の画面に進みます。
ライセンス契約書の内容を確認し、同意のチェックボックスにチェックを入れます。インストール先フォルダはデフォルト設定のまま進めることをお勧めしますが、特定のディレクトリにインストールしたい場合は「Browse」ボタンから変更可能です。
コンポーネントの選択画面では、「Full Installation」を選択することで、すべての機能を利用できます。カスタムインストールを選択した場合は、必要な機能のみを個別に選択してください。インストール処理には5-10分程度の時間がかかります。

macOS環境でのインストール手順

macOS環境でのインストール手順

Mac環境では、ダウンロードしたdmgファイルをダブルクリックしてマウントします。表示されるウィンドウ内のClaude Codeアイコンを、Applicationsフォルダにドラッグ&ドロップしてインストールを実行します。
初回起動時にセキュリティ警告が表示される場合があります。この場合は、システム環境設定のセキュリティとプライバシーから「このまま開く」を選択して、アプリケーションの実行を許可してください。
Gatekeeperの設定によって起動が阻害される場合は、ターミナルアプリケーションから「sudo spctl –master-disable」コマンドを実行することで、一時的にセキュリティ制限を解除できます。ただし、インストール完了後は必ずセキュリティ設定を元に戻すことを忘れないでください。

Linux環境でのインストール手順

Linux環境では、配布パッケージの形式に応じてインストール方法が異なります。Debianベースのディストリビューションの場合、「sudo dpkg -i claude-code.deb」コマンドでパッケージをインストールできます。
RPMベースのシステムでは、「sudo rpm -ivh claude-code.rpm」コマンドを使用します。依存関係のエラーが発生した場合は、「sudo yum install」または「sudo dnf install」コマンドで必要なライブラリを事前にインストールしてください。
AppImageファイルが提供されている場合は、ファイルに実行権限を付与後、直接実行することで起動できます。「chmod +x Claude-Code.AppImage」「./Claude-Code.AppImage」の順序でコマンドを実行してください。

初期設定とアカウント連携

初期設定とアカウント連携

インストール完了後の初回起動時には、アカウント認証が必要になります。先ほど作成したアカウント情報を使用してログインし、デバイスの認証を完了させてください。
言語設定、テーマの選択、キーボードショートカットのカスタマイズなど、基本的な環境設定を行います。これらの設定は後から変更可能ですが、初期段階で適切に設定することで、より効率的な作業環境を構築できます。
プロジェクトのワークスペース設定も重要な要素です。デフォルトのプロジェクトフォルダを指定し、バージョン管理システムとの連携設定を行います。Gitリポジトリとの連携により、チーム開発における協調作業が大幅に改善されます。

動作確認とサンプルプロジェクト

設定完了後は、Claude Codeが正常に動作することを確認するため、サンプルプロジェクトの作成を行いましょう。「New Project」メニューから「Sample Application」を選択し、簡単なWebアプリケーションプロジェクトを生成します。
サンプルプロジェクトには、HTMLファイル、CSSスタイルシート、JavaScriptファイルが含まれており、Claude Codeの基本機能を体験できるように設計されています。コード補完機能、構文ハイライト、エラー検出機能などが適切に動作することを確認してください。
デバッグ機能のテストも重要です。意図的にエラーを含むコードを作成し、Claude Codeがどのように問題を検出し、修正提案を行うかを確認しましょう。この段階で機能に問題がある場合は、設定の見直しまたは再インストールを検討してください。

トラブルシューティングガイド

インストールや初期設定の過程で問題が発生した場合の対処法をご紹介します。最も一般的な問題の一つは、ライセンス認証の失敗です。この場合は、インターネット接続を確認し、ファイアウォールの設定を見直してください。
起動時のクラッシュが発生する場合は、システムの互換性に問題がある可能性があります。最新のグラフィックドライバーの更新、.NET Frameworkの最新版インストールなどを試してください。
メモリ不足によるパフォーマンス問題が発生した場合は、仮想メモリの設定を見直すか、不要なアプリケーションを終了してリソースを確保してください。大規模なプロジェクトを扱う際は、特にメモリ管理が重要になります。

まとめ

Claude Codeのインストールと初期設定は、手順に従って進めれば決して難しいものではありません。事前準備を適切に行い、システム要件を満たした環境で作業することが成功の鍵となります。
初回インストール時には時間がかかる場合もありますが、一度環境が整えば、開発効率の大幅な向上を実感できるでしょう。継続的なアップデートと設定の最適化により、さらに快適な開発環境を構築することが可能です。
困った時は公式サポートやコミュニティフォーラムを活用し、他のユーザーの経験を参考にしながら問題解決に取り組んでください。適切なインストールと設定により、Claude Codeの真の力を最大限に活用できるようになります。

ABOUT ME
松本大輔
LIXILで磨いた「クオリティーファースト」の哲学とAIの可能性への情熱を兼ね備えた経営者。2022年の転身を経て、2025年1月にRe-BIRTH株式会社を創設。CEOとして革新的AIソリューション開発に取り組む一方、Re-HERO社COOとColorful School DAO代表も兼任。マーケティング、NFT、AIを融合した独自モデルで競合を凌駕し、「生み出す」と「復活させる」という使命のもと、新たな価値創造に挑戦している。

著書:
AI共存時代の人間革命
YouTube成功戦略ガイド
SNS完全攻略ガイド
AI活用術